public IEnumerable <Employee> EMPGet(int id) { EMPContext dataContext = new EMPContext(); var employees = dataContext.Employee.Where(x => x.employeeId == id); return(employees); }
public IEnumerable <Employee> Get() { using (EMPContext dataContext = new EMPContext()) { var employees = dataContext.Employee.ToList(); return(employees); } }
public IActionResult EMPDelete(int id) { EMPContext datacontext = new EMPContext(); var emp_val = datacontext.Employee.FindAsync(id); datacontext.Remove(emp_val); datacontext.SaveChanges(); return(Ok()); }
public IActionResult EMPPost(Employee emp) { using (EMPContext dataContext = new EMPContext()) { dataContext.Employee.Add(emp); dataContext.SaveChanges(); } return(CreatedAtAction("Get", emp)); }
public IActionResult EMPPut(int id, Employee emp) { if (id != emp.employeeId) { return(BadRequest()); } using (EMPContext dataContext = new EMPContext()) { dataContext.SaveChanges(); } return(CreatedAtAction("Get", emp)); }